OpenAI has announced a significant enhancement to its ChatGPT service, making its deep research tool available to all users, including those on the free plan. The new offering, powered by the o4-mini model, is designed to provide users with a lightweight yet nearly as capable version of the original deep research tool.

This move comes as OpenAI aims to increase accessibility and usability for its users. The new tool will be available to all ChatGPT users, including those on the free plan, Plus, Team, and Pro subscriptions. According to OpenAI, the lightweight version will allow for higher usage limits, making it more convenient for users to access deep research features.

The company has also announced that if users hit their cap on the full version, the system will automatically switch to the lightweight one. This ensures that users can still access deep research features without interruption, even when their usage exceeds the limits of the full version.

OpenAI's CEO, Sam Altman, confirmed that starting April 30, the legacy GPT-4 model will be phased out of ChatGPT, with GPT-4o becoming the default model for all users. This transition aims to enhance the performance and efficiency of the ChatGPT service.

The introduction of the lightweight deep research tool aligns with OpenAI's strategy to make its advanced AI tools more accessible to a broader audience. This move is likely to attract more users to the platform, especially those who are looking for a cost-effective way to leverage deep research capabilities.
